TITLE 312 NATURAL RESOURCES COMMISSION

Proposed Rule
LSA Document #07-749

DIGEST

Amends 312 IAC 9-3-12 to prohibit the sale and possession of coyotes taken outside the hunting and trapping season. Amends 312 IAC 9-3-14.5, which governs the taking and possession of coyotes, to allow untanned hides and carcasses of coyotes to be possessed for not more than 20 days after the close of the season. Effective 30 days after filing with the Publisher.




SECTION 1. 312 IAC 9-3-12, PROPOSED TO BE AMENDED AT 20080130-IR-312070659PRA, SECTION 2, IS AMENDED TO READ AS FOLLOWS:

312 IAC 9-3-12 Foxes, coyotes, and skunks

Authority: IC 14-10-2-4; IC 14-22-2-6
Affected: IC 14-22


Sec. 12. (a) The season for hunting:
(1) red foxes (Vulpes vulpes); and
(2) gray foxes (Urocyon cinereoargenteus);
is from noon on October 15 until noon on February 28 of the following year.

(b) The season for trapping:
(1) red foxes (Vulpes vulpes); and
(2) gray foxes (Urocyon cinereoargenteus);
is from 8 a.m. on October 15 until noon on January 31 of the following year.

(c) Except as provided in subsection (d), the season for:
(1) hunting:
(A) coyotes (Canis latrans); and
(B) striped skunks (Mephitis mephitis);
is from noon on October 15 until noon on March 15 of the following year; and
(2) trapping:
(A) coyotes (Canis latrans); and
(B) striped skunks (Mephitis mephitis);
is from 8 a.m. on October 15 until noon on March 15 of the following year.
A coyote must not be possessed from April 5 through October 14 except to provide for its prompt disposal.

(d) A person who possesses land, or another person designated in writing by that person, may take coyotes on that land at any time. A coyote taken under this subsection from March 16 through October 14:
(1) must be euthanized within twenty-four (24) hours of capture; and
(2) shall not be:
(A) possessed for more than twenty-four (24) hours;
(B) sold;
(C) traded;
(D) bartered; or
(E) gifted.

SECTION 2. 312 IAC 9-3-14.5, PROPOSED TO BE ADDED AT 20080130-IR-312070659PRA, SECTION 5, IS AMENDED TO READ AS FOLLOWS:

312 IAC 9-3-14.5 Possession of furbearing mammals

Authority: IC 14-10-2-4; IC 14-22-2-6
Affected: IC 14-22


Sec. 14.5. (a) A person must not possess the untanned hide or unprocessed carcass of any of the following species that have been lawfully taken for more than twenty (20) days after the close of the hunting or trapping season:
(1) Red fox (Vulpes vulpes).
(2) Gray fox (Urocyon cinereoargenteus).
(3) Striped skunk (Mephitis mephitis).
(4) Beaver (Castor canadensis).
(5) Mink (Mustela vison).
(6) Muskrat (Ondatra zibethicus).
(7) Long-tailed weasel (Mustela frenata).
(8) Virginia opossum (Didelphis marsupialis).
(9) Raccoon (Procyon lotor).
(10) Coyote (Canis latrans).

(b) A person must not possess a live furbearing mammal listed in subsection (a) outside the hunting or trapping season except as otherwise authorized under this article.
